Transaction 6c3ae269285e8f61b8857c23bc9018632b0637b5a696daac8dbffc794e2571ce
1 Input
2 Outputs
- 6c3ae269285e8f61b8857c23bc9018632b0637b5a696daac8dbffc794e2571ce:0
- 6c3ae269285e8f61b8857c23bc9018632b0637b5a696daac8dbffc794e2571ce:1
value 597000
address 126QNWYkP2TjrWCTkx6Tvg3eTtHNwwMdmN
value 17528331
address 18FyUrTkRE9cCLXX1x78XzCRQ8T87vSkG4